مرحبا بالجميع!
لقد حدث أنني من نفس خدمة مراقبة الجودة. فريقنا كتب مؤخرًا ميزة كبيرة. بعد أن انعكست قليلاً ، قررت إنشاء ورقة غش كهذه للواجهة الأمامية. سيذكرك ما الذي تبحث عنه قبل نقل المهمة إلى الاختبار.
عند إرسال الإصدار النهائي للمنتج إلى خدمة مراقبة الجودة ، يجب أن تتوقع أن عنصر التحكم لن يكشف عن أي مشاكل. سيكون من غير المهني للغاية تمرير رمز معيب عن علم لمراقبة الجودة. وأي كود معيب بشكل واضح؟ أي شخص لست متأكدًا منه!
"مبرمج مثالي. كيف تصبح محترف تطوير برامج »
روبرت س مارتن
من أين تبدأ؟
تخطيط على النماذج الأولية .
يحدث أن يكون المصممون عبارة عن أعمدة جميلة من برج عالٍ ، و "يرونها بهذه الطريقة". وأحيانًا يكون من السهل القيام بذلك بطريقتك الخاصة بدلاً من اتباع النموذج الأولي. لكن هؤلاء الأشخاص عادة ما يكونون إلى جانبنا ، وعند الرسم ، يتمسكون في الرأس (أو على الورق) ببعض الحجج التي تدور حول سبب ذلك في أي قيمة. وإذا بدا أن شيئًا غريبًا قد تم رسمه ، فيمكنك دائمًا مناقشته.
إذا كان هناك شيء مستحيل (اقرأ مكلف للغاية) - فهذا ما يجب أن أقوله. غبي جدًا جدًا لرؤية نماذج جديدة لا تتقارب مع المهمة الجديدة.
البحث عن الاختلافات N. النموذج الأولي على اليسار.تعبئة وعرض البيانات
كل شيء على ما يرام عندما تكون المعلومات الموجودة على الموقع ثابتة ولم تتغير. يمكنك أن ترى في زوج من المتصفحات والعديد من القرارات. سيجد هذا على الفور مشاكل واضحة ويصلحها قبل الاختبار.
لكن كل شيء يتغير عندما تكون -
الإدخال .
من الضروري للغاية إدخال كل شيء فيها:
- الكثير من النص.
- نص مختلف: الحروف والأرقام والأحرف الخاصة ، إلخ.
- النص قليلا. لا يمكنني إدخال شيء وكيف سيبدو بعد ذلك؟
- نص تنسيق خاطئ أو نص غير صالح.
- للحلوى: خطوط كبيرة مع عدم وجود مسافات على الإطلاق.
- الثغرات: الرائدة والزائدة.
النص المخفيقد تتساءل الواجهة الأمامية النموذجية: كم نص كم؟ لدي إجابة لهذا: بقدر ما تنسجم مع المدخلات. لا يوجد حد طول؟ يمكنك إدخال 10-20 ألف حرف وإلقاء نظرة على النتيجة. ربما الخلفية الخاصة بك ليست مستعدة لمثل هذه المجلدات؟ لمدة دقيقة ، 20 ألف حرف - هذا هو مقدار:
A4 ، Times New Roman ، 12 نقطة ، تباعد الأسطر - 1. حول المسافات البادئة والزائدة.
ليست هناك حاجة في 99 ٪ من الحالات ، باستثناء ، ربما ، فقط لكلمات المرور ، ولكن هذا غير دقيق. واجهت تجربة عندما تعطل التطبيق بسبب وجود مساحة في نهاية تسجيل الدخول. بقي بعد نسخ الخط من البريد. لذلك:
تقليم المساحات !
مجرد إدخال القيم هو نصف القصة فقط. بالإضافة إلى الحفظ ، تحتاج إلى إلقاء نظرة على الشاشة. لذلك ، نتحقق من ظهور البيانات التي تم إدخالها مسبقًا: الأنماط ، والزينة ، والتنسيق ، إلخ. أي شيء يمكن أن يذهب.
تحقق كل نفس:
- نصوص كبيرة ، مع أو بدون مسافات.
- النصوص مع فواصل الأسطر ، الفقرات. في بعض الأحيان أدرج قصائد لهذا.
- الحد الأدنى لمجموعة البيانات. هل يبقى كل شيء في مكانه عندما لا يوجد شيء أو لا شيء تقريبا؟
- عرض ليس كل الحقول من كيان معقد. قد تكون فارغة.
هناك بعض الأمثلة الحية تحت القط.
النص المخفي
نص طويل لا ينفصم يخرج.
دفع النص الهوامش في الجهاز اللوحي من بعده.
التفاف النص مقابل IE.
كيان مع العديد من الحقول ، ولكن اثنين فقط من تستخدم في القائمة. وهذه هي الطريقة التي تبدو الحقول الفارغة.
ضاقت فقط نافذة المتصفح. التصديقات
في بعض الأحيان لا يمكنك فقط أخذ ما تريد
وإدخاله - تعمل عمليات
التحقق من الصحة .
ما يجب القيام به
نلقي نظرة على قائمة عمليات التحقق ، ولكل واحد منهم نتحقق من أنها أقسمت. أي قيود الطول ، الأحرف الممنوعة ، قناع الإدخال - كل هذا يجب التحقق منه والتأكد من أنه يعمل.
تلميح: يمكن أيضًا إدخال النص عن طريق النسخ.
IE
أنا أفهم أن رد الفعل الأول هو بعض من هذا القبيل.

أنت محظوظ إذا كان لديك عدد قليل من المستخدمين لهذا المتصفح الرائع. ولكن إذا لم يكن كذلك ، ثم للأسف. سيكون عليك إلقاء نظرة على عملك من خلال منظور الإدراك البديل.
المقاييس
يشبه الإصدار IE تقريبًا ، لكنه غير مؤلم.
إذا لم يتم جمع أي مقاييس مخصصة في مشروعك ، فسيكون كل شيء على ما يرام. خلاف ذلك ، عليك أن تفعل شيئين:
- تعليق جميع المقاييس على الإجراءات المطلوبة. في تجربتي ، جاءت المعلومات حول المقاييس إما من التحليلات ، أو كان الباعة الأماميون أنفسهم على دراية بذلك.
- تحقق من إرسال المقاييس الصحيحة مع البيانات الصحيحة إلى الإجراءات. على الأقل الإخراج إلى وحدة التحكم في وضع ديف.
بدلا من الاستنتاج
تحدثت لفترة وجيزة عن ما يجب الانتباه إليه عند العمل مع الجبهة. هذه الشيكات القليلة ستتيح لك الحصول على منتج أفضل بكثير في الإخراج.
أود أن أشير إلى أن المقالة ستكون مفيدة إذا لم يكن لديك اختبار على الإطلاق. لذلك ، في النهاية مرة أخرى ملخص موجز:
- تخطيط على النماذج الأولية.
- أدخل مجموعة متنوعة من البيانات: لا تدخل كثيرًا ، قليلًا ، في كلمة واحدة.
- تقليم المساحات.
- تحقق من صحة.
- IE.
- لا تنس المقاييس.
التعليمات
س: سيجد الفاحصون كل شيء!
ج: ليس كل شيء. المختبرين ليسوا مرشح HEPA لك ، ولكن الناس. وإذا لم يقم شخص ما في مرحلة التطوير بأداء دوره في العمل ، فإنه لا يذهب إلى أي مكان ، ولكنه ينتقل ببساطة إلى شخص آخر.
اشتعلت ، ولكن لم ننظر؟ لذلك سيعمل أشخاص آخرون مع هذا ، وقضاء الوقت ليس فقط ، ولكن أيضا نقاط قوتهم. يتعب الشخص ، وتغسل العين ويتراكم التعب. وما وراء هذه المشاكل ، قد يتم تفويت أشياء أكثر خطورة.
أيضًا ، لا تنس أن أي لعبة ذات مهام ping-pong لا تفرض سوى تكاليف وقت إضافية. لا يزال من الضروري الانتهاء بشكل طبيعي. لكن الاكتشاف المبكر للمشاكل يسرع عملية التطوير بأكملها.
شكرا لاهتمامكم